Atlantico Baiano — Contrary to the other areas I’ve talked about to date, Atlantico Baiano’s tiny farms are set in very low-altitude rising spots. Also atypical is the character from the crop — mainly Robusta beans instead of the Arabica beans which might be grown all over Significantly of your nation.

Robusta beans are considerably less prevalent in Brazil, accounting for only about thirty% of your region's coffee production. Robusta beans have a much better, a lot more bitter flavor and higher caffeine information when compared to Arabica beans. The Robusta beans grown in Brazil are mostly Utilized in blends and quick coffee.

Coffee was not native to Brazil, and the 1st coffee bush was planted by Francisco de Melo Palheta in Pará in 1727. On the other hand, it was not till the early nineteenth century that coffee manufacturing began to acquire off in Brazil.

Together with Arabica, Brazil also grows Robusta, that's simpler to increase and has more caffeine and crema. Ordinarily, espresso blends typically contain 70% Brazilian pulped purely natural, fifteen% robusta, and also a sprint of Central American coffee for additional spice.

Brazil’s coffee-making locations are certainly assorted with different levels of altitudes, plant types, and manufacturing techniques. Some are in large-altitude, mountainous regions exactly where coffee must be handpicked; Other individuals expand on flat farms in which labor could be mechanized.
